Compressed Natural Gas (CNG)

1.Advantages of CNG

 

Under normal temperature and high pressure (20~25MPa), the quality of natural gas with the same volume is about 270~300 times larger than that under high pressure conditions, which can greatly improve the storage and transportation volume of natural gas and make the utilization of natural gas more convenient. Nowadays, CNG is widely used in transportation, urban gas and industrial production.

 

Currently, both at home and abroad are vigorously developing alternative automotive vehicle fuels, and the practical applications include compressed natural gas (CNG), liquefied natural gas (LNG), liquefied petroleum gas (LPG), methanol, ethanol and electric energy.



2.Classification of CNG Station

 

At present, the classification of CNG stations is not unified yet. According to the purpose of gas supply, it can be generally divided into pressurization station, gas supply station and gas filling station; According to the function setting, it can be divided into single-function station, dual-function station and multi-function station; According to different affiliation, it can be divided into independent station and chain station.



3.CNG Station Process

 

The basic functions of CNG station are natural gas receiving (incoming pressure regulation and metering), processing, compression, supply (including storage, gas filling supply and decompression supply), etc. LPG and LNG stations are usually included, but the in-station process flow is different from that in CNG stations.
